Comet Industries (CVE:CMU) Hits New 52-Week High – Should You Buy?

Comet Industries Ltd. (CVE:CMUGet Free Report) reached a new 52-week high during trading on Tuesday . The company traded as high as C$6.35 and last traded at C$6.35, with a volume of 446 shares. The stock had previously closed at C$6.25.

Comet Industries Stock Down 1.6%

The company has a market capitalization of C$29.97 million, a P/E ratio of -41.67 and a beta of -0.70.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.73, a quick ratio of 6.63 and a current ratio of 401.62. The stock has a 50 day moving average price of C$4.25 and a 200 day moving average price of C$4.15.

Comet Industries Company Profile

Comet Industries Ltd. holds and manages real estate properties in the British Columbia. It also acquires and develops mineral properties. The company holds a 40% working interest in the Iron Mask property located in southwest Kamloops, British Columbia. It also owns a 10% carried net profit interest in a contiguous block of mineral properties; and the surface land titles comprising the crown grants located in Kamloops, British Columbia. In addition, the company holds, and rents land and a commercial building located at the corner of Carrall and Powell Streets in the Gastown area of Vancouver, Canada.
